What a full brushing appointment actually covers

Glossy before-and-after pictures inform just a bit of the story. A comprehensive bridegroom normally consists of a health-adjacent check that can locate trouble long before a vet see is required. Competent pet groomers Reno NV owners count on do more than clip and wash.

For pet dogs, a full-service bridegroom begins with a pre-bath evaluation of layer problem and skin. A groomer will certainly feel for mats behind ears, in the underarms, and under the collar. They will certainly search for burrs or sap, keep in mind ear smell, and check the tail base where locations flare in summer. After that comes a warm bathroom with a hair shampoo fit to the coat and skin. For example, Reno's completely dry air makes gentle, moisturizing formulas useful for short-coated same-day grooming appointments types in wintertime. Conditioners or de-shedding therapies add slip that aids release undercoat in double-coated pet dogs like huskies, guards, and retrievers. Post-bath, drying is a large piece of the security puzzle. Hand-drying with a high velocity clothes dryer speeds the procedure and lifts loose hair, but it must be paired with hearing security for the canine and cautious surveillance. Cage clothes dryers prevail also, ideally space temperature or reduced warm, with timers and supervision.

The completing phase, the component lots of people consider grooming, is coat-specific. A doodle or poodle mix will need scissoring and clipper work with careful brushing to avoid blades from skipping over concealed knots. A golden or husky ought to not cat-safe grooming products be cut for benefit unless a vet has a clinical factor, since that coat shields against heat and sunburn. Instead, use de-shedding and clean trims to keep feathering tidy. Nails, paw pads, and hygienic trims round out the service. Nail length matters in our trail-heavy community; disordered nails alter joint angles and can harm on granite or decomposed granite courses around Galena Creek and Peavine.

Cat grooming is a different craft. Pet cats have slim, delicate skin and a reduced tolerance for restriction and noise. Good cat grooming solutions are quieter, faster, and lower tension. Many felines do well with a bath and comb-out for shedding periods, plus hygienic and stubborn belly trims for long-haired breeds. A full lion cut is an option for greatly matted coats or for elderly pet cats who no longer self-groom, but it should be done thoughtfully to avoid sun exposure in summer. Some cats just will not endure a hair salon environment. Mobile brushing or cat-only days can lower stress. Sedation needs to be dealt with by a veterinarian, not by a groomer.

Reno-specific layer challenges and just how to consider them

Season, altitude, and terrain alter the brushing image here.

In winter season, completely dry air and interior warm can lead to dandruff and itchy skin. A groomer might suggest extending the bath interval slightly and including a mild conditioner. Booties help on salted sidewalks, yet not all pets approve them. A paw balm and even more regular pad trims keep ice rounds from creating between toes after a walking at Thomas Creek.

Spring and early summertime bring foxtails. These barbed turf awns can infiltrate layers, paws, and ears, and they are much easier to avoid than to eliminate at a veterinarian. Ask your groomer to pay unique focus to feet, underarms, under the tail, and the edge of the ear leather. Brief trims in those risky areas can assist while preserving the stability of dual coats.

Summer fun around rivers, Lake Tahoe excursion, or a dip at Triggers Marina leaves layers wet. Quick drying is not practically convenience. Dampness trapped under thick coats can develop locations within a day. A specialist blowout after water experiences can conserve you a veterinarian check out. Rinse after freshwater swims, specifically if algae advisories have actually been published in the region, and routine an appropriate bath to remove residue.

Fall is sticker label period. Burrs and cheatgrass cling to downy legs and tails. This is when routine comb-outs in the house extend the time in between complete brushing check outs. For long-haired cats that track burrs inside from Downtown backyards or the Old Southwest, a hygienic trim and paw fur tidy can minimize the mess.

How to evaluate a pet groomer without being a professional

The ideal indicator of a reputable pet groomer is consistent, tranquil animals entering and coming out, and a store that scents tidy without hefty perfumes concealing other smells. Reno has a mix of store hair salons, mobile vans, and larger operations. Instead of chasing the trendiest Instagram, utilize a couple of practical filters.

First, seek transparent plans. You want clear check-in procedures, launch types that explain drying methods, flea policies, and what happens if your pet shows indications of tension. Ask who will certainly work on your pet dog and whether the very same individual can deal with most visits for continuity. Peek at the holding locations. Some pet dogs remainder fine in kennels, others do much better in a tiny room divided by gateways. Neither is naturally right, however an excellent family pet brushing service matches the configuration to the dog.

Second, ask about training. Nevada, like a lot of states, does not have an official state license specific to grooming, so you are looking for trade accreditations, mentorship, and recurring education and learning rather than a government-issued credential. Fear Free accreditation, PetTech emergency treatment training, or memberships in professional associations reveal intent to keep abilities present. Experience with your certain coat type matters greater than any shiny device. A groomer who services three goldendoodles a day will certainly have various grooming packages and pricing hands-on understanding than someone who specializes in terrier hand-stripping.

Third, check the drying out strategy. Drying is where a lot of danger lives. The inquiry to ask is easy: exactly how do you dry a double-coated canine, and just how do you keep track of pets while they dry? Affordable solutions mention high velocity hand-drying for a lot of the layer, cage dryers readied to ambient or reduced warm, timers, and consistent personnel visibility in the drying out area.

Finally, research before-and-after photos with an eye for layer integrity and expression, not simply ideal bows. Look at feet, tail set, and face balance. On cats, check out just how close the lion cut takes place the body and whether the neck change looks smooth as opposed to greatly edged.

Pricing you can expect in the Truckee Meadows

Rates vary with dimension, coat type, and condition, however many pet groomers Reno residents use come under a predictable range. Bathroom and brush solutions for small short-haired pet dogs typically run in the 40 to 60 buck variety. Complete grooms for tiny to tool types that require clipper work, believe shih tzu or cockapoo, usually land between 65 and 120 dollars relying on coat problem. Huge double-coated canines needing de-shedding are typically 80 to 140 dollars, sometimes a lot more throughout peak shed period if the undercoat is impacted. Pet cats are generally 70 to 120 dollars for a bathroom and neat, with lion cuts on the greater end because of the skill and safety factors to consider. Mobile solutions typically include 10 to 30 dollars over beauty parlor prices, reflecting traveling time and special attention.

There are additional charges that can stun people. Serious matting takes time and must be dealt with securely, which usually means a short clip instead of brushing out limited knots that pluck skin. Senior pets and special delivery for fear or aggressiveness may add price. A good store describes these fees in advance and obtains approval prior to proceeding if the estimate needs to change.

How way out to book and why timing issues in Reno

Grooming timetables below adhere to the weather. Late springtime via early summer is peak for shedding. Around that time, several shops publication two to three weeks out for complete bridegrooms. Holiday weeks fill quick also. To stay clear of the shuffle, established a recurring timetable that matches your pet's coat. For a doodle kept in a tool clip, every 4 to 6 weeks keeps hair manageable and stops matting. For double-coated types, a bathroom and blowout every 6 to 8 weeks through springtime and early summertime makes home cleaning much easier. Short-coated pets can often go 8 to twelve weeks in between specialist baths, with nail trims in between.

Cats have their very own rhythm. Long-haired pet cats often take advantage of seasonal visits in springtime and autumn, plus sanitary trims as needed. Older cats or those with health and wellness problems may require much more frequent aid as grooming becomes uneasy for them.

Safety concerns that separate a mindful shop from a risky one

Hygiene is not attractive, but it matters. Devices should be sanitized between pets, towels cleaned warm, and bathtubs disinfected after every use. If your pet dog picks up a skin infection after swimming, tell the groomer so they can adjust products and methods. Inoculation plans vary, however several hair salons call for evidence of rabies at minimum. Some request for Bordetella for dogs, specifically in more busy stores. If your pet dog has a contagious issue like fleas, anticipate the appointment to be rescheduled or transferred to an isolated port with a flea therapy and a sanitation fee. That is good policy, not a money grab.

Emergencies are uncommon, but plans ought to exist. Ask how the staff deals with a clipper nick, what first aid training they have, and which veterinary center they call if something urgent takes place. You will learn a whole lot regarding a group by exactly how they answer.

A closer consider cat grooming, because it is its very own world

Many animal groomers enjoy pet cats yet do not accept them, and that is reasonable. Pet cat grooming requires a quieter area, company yet mild handling, and an efficient approach. A proper feline arrangement limits canines in the room, makes use of non-slip floor coverings, and shortens the consultation. Scruffing ought to be avoided for towel covers or a groomer's helper to maintain safely when needed. For long-haired felines, regular comb-outs with a stainless steel comb are much more reliable than slicker brushes at stopping floor coverings at the skin level. When a layer is already showered, the humane choice is a brief clip. The right groomer will not shame you, they will obtain your feline comfortable once more and assist you prepare a maintenance schedule.

Mobile grooming beams with cats, specifically older ones from neighborhoods like Caughlin Cattle ranch or Double Ruby who are made use of to quiet. Individually sessions reduce noise and scent triggers. If your pet cat requires sedation to tolerate grooming, talk with your veterinarian beforehand. A groomer can not lawfully, and must not morally, administer sedatives.

Matting, shave-downs, and when a shortcut is the right choice

Coat treatment has compromises. Cleaning out extreme floor coverings hurts and high-risk. Clipper blades ride on a padding of hair. When hair is tight to skin, blades can catch. A compassionate groomer will certainly suggest a brief clip if floor coverings are thick at the skin. This is not a failure, it is a reset. Afterwards reset, a sensible upkeep strategy may be a much shorter style every four to six weeks plus fast comb-outs in the house every other day. For an owner with a hectic routine, that strategy maintains a doodle or Persian comfortable.

Shaving double layers is a different issue. Individuals commonly ask for a summer shave to keep a husky cool. That undercoat functions as insulation against heat and sun. A close cut gets rid of that feature and can change layer appearance as it regrows. Better to schedule a bath and de-shedding treatment, then tidy paws, tummy, and hygienic locations, and make use of shade, amazing water, and time of day to take care of heat.

Nails, paws, and the Reno trail life

We live outside here. Nails that are as well long catch on disintegrated granite and alter the method joints pile, which gradually can make hips and wrists harmed. A lot of dogs take advantage of trims every 2 to 4 weeks, extra often if the quicks are long and require to recede slowly. Ask your groomer to reveal you exactly how to maintain at home with a grinder, and routine stand-alone nail visits in between complete bridegrooms. Paw pads grab sap, burs, and micro cuts, particularly on the Hunter Creek trail and Galena's granite actions. A pad balm after walks assists, and a fast rinse in the bathtub or at a self-wash removes bothersome dust.

A few neighborhood quirks worth noting

Reno's climate can change by 30 levels within a week. Skin that looked penalty in a damp March can be flaky by April. Shops in some cases switch hair shampoos seasonally for regulars, utilizing oatmeal or aloe blends throughout the driest months and lighter cleansers after summertime swims. Likewise, wildfire smoke affects skin and lungs. On heavy smoke days, maintain exterior time short and schedule indoor, low-stress activities for dogs. If a pet dog coughings or has runny eyes, inform your groomer. They can maintain the session mild and avoid heavy fragrances.

Finally, we live near high desert plants that leave persistent materials. Pine sap and tumbleweed fragments can adhesive hair hairs with each other. Do not deal with those with scissors in the house. A solvent-based, pet-safe item and person combing after a bathroom typically wins without reducing an opening in the coat.

What are the red flags for dog grooming?

Red flags in dog grooming include unsanitary tools, aggressive handling of dogs, lack of proper certification, and signs of neglect or stress in pets. Long waiting times, hidden fees, or unclear service policies can also indicate issues. Communication and transparency are key. Observing the environment and staff behavior helps identify reliable groomers.
